The Writer’s Block was founded in late 2014 by married couple Scott Seeley and Drew Cohen, who moved to Las Vegas from New York City.
A veteran of the original McSweeney’s retail store and co-founder of the literary nonprofit 826NYC, Seeley envisioned The Writer’s Block as a spiritual successor to both these projects: a novel and visually dense bookstore that offered free, creative writing classes to Las Vegas-area students and their families.
Originally debuting on Vegas’s iconic Fremont Street corridor as part of Downtown Project’s start-up portfolio, The Writer’s Block reopened in 2019 at a brand-new location, the Lucy, with the backing of local literary philanthropist Beverly Rogers. Spring
